Misdirection (okay) Another spell useful for evading detection based on your auras is Misdirection , a level 2 spell which disguises your aura by making you appear to be something else; however, it is overcome by a simple Will save by the detector, so does …The important part here is that the amulet will shield you against scrying, because of how Scrying targets you. Detect Magic for instance, is an AoE, it doesn't target you. The amulet will absolutely prevent Detect Magic from recording "you"... just in case you were actually magical. This silver amulet protects the wearer from scrying and magical location just as a nondetection spell does. If a divination spell is attempted against the wearer, the caster of the divination must succeed on a caster level check (1d20 + caster level) against a DC of 19 (as if the caster had cast nondetection on herself).While wearing this amulet, ... See full list on rpg.stackexchange.com The "proof against detection and location" is designed to prevent Scrying magic, not seeing someone via sight (or enhanced sight like True Seeing). The "you are hidden from divination magic" is basically flavour text. The second sentence tells you what the spell actually does.
